I managed to get kms + X working on a Lenovo Miix 2 today (basically same chip
that the Dell Venue pro 8) with 3.13 + F20:
I used both hints given by Jacek: append "video=VGA-1:800x1280 at 60" to the
command line and revert commit 6c4a8962a4a078cacfc8eb5d4bd79f6343b8cd7a.
This gives a good kms on a 3.13 kernel (no black screen anymore, console OK),
but X fails with garbled display. So I just add the correct mode to xorg.conf
(attached), and it's ok now.
I will try later the latest intel-drm tree to see if it has been fixed
upstream, but I think it is "just" that the intel CRC do not manage to get the
correct EDID to the attached display.
